隨著互聯網技術的發展,前端開發在網頁設計中的作用越來越重要。其中,CSS3作為一個設計樣式表語言,為網頁設計帶來了許多奇妙的效果。
CSS3相對于CSS2的擴展功能更加強大,具有更多的選擇器和屬性,同時也增加了一些新的特性。這里我們就來介紹一下CSS3的一些常見的特性及使用方法。
/*Border Radius實現圓角矩形*/ .box{ border-radius: 10px; -webkit-border-radius: 10px; -moz-border-radius: 10px; } /*Box Shadow實現陰影*/ .box{ box-shadow: 5px 5px 5px grey; -webkit-box-shadow: 5px 5px 5px grey; -moz-box-shadow: 5px 5px 5px grey; } /*Text Shadow實現文字陰影*/ h1{ text-shadow: 2px 2px black; } /*Transform實現旋轉和縮放*/ .box{ transform: rotate(45deg); -webkit-transform: rotate(45deg); -moz-transform: rotate(45deg); } /*Animation實現動畫*/ .box{ animation: mymove 5s infinite; -webkit-animation: mymove 5s infinite; -moz-animation: mymove 5s infinite; } /*@media查詢實現響應式布局*/ @media screen and (max-width: 768px) { .box{ width: 100%; } }
以上就是CSS3的一些基本特性。當然,在實際運用中,要根據具體業務需求進行詳細的選擇和實現。
總之,CSS3為前端開發者提供了更多的創意和實現方式,讓網頁設計更加精彩。尤其是在移動端的頁面設計中,更是發揮了巨大的作用。因此,前端開發者要不斷學習掌握CSS3,為用戶提供更好的頁面體驗。